操作系统的启动流程具体有那些?

 

  操作系统的启动流程(*****)

  BIOS介绍

  BIOS:Basic Input Output System

  BIOS被写入ROM设备

  裸机

  CPU

  ROM:充当内存,存放BIOS系统

  CMOS:充当硬盘

  操作系统的启动流程(*****)

  计算机加电

  BIOS开始运行,检测硬件(CPU、内存、硬盘等)

  BIOS读取CMOS存储器中的参数,选择启动设备

  从启动设备上读取第一个扇区的内容(MBR主引导记录512字节,前446为引导信息,后64为分区信息,最后两个为标志位)

  根据分区信息读入bootloader启动装载模块,启动操作系统

  操作系统询问BIOS,以获得配置信息。对于每种设备,系统会检查其设备驱动程序是否存在,如果没有,系统则会要求用户安装驱动程序,一旦有了驱动程序,操作系统就将它们调入内核

  BIOS

  存有win10系统的光盘、u盘、移动硬盘:无密码

  本地硬盘上的win7系统:密码

  应用程序的启动流程(*****)

  双击exe快捷方式–》exe文件的绝对路径,就是在告诉操作系

  说:我有一个应用程序要执行,应用程序的文件路径是(exe文件的绝对路径)

  操作系统会根据文件路径找到exe程序在硬盘的位置,控制其代码从硬盘加载到内存

  然后控制cpu从内存中读取刚刚读入内存的应用程序的代码执行,应用程序完成启动


原文链接:https://blog.csdn.net/qq_40555661/article/details/106220300

上一篇:磁盘分区格式(MBR分区和GPT分区)和启动引导模式(Legacy和UEFI)的关系


下一篇:循环及增强for循环、Debug